Causes and Symptoms of Severe Diaper Rash

Severe diaper rash can be caused by a variety of factors, including prolonged exposure to urine and feces, friction from tight diapers, and allergic reactions to diaper materials or wipes. It’s essential to identify the cause of the rash to provide the best treatment. Symptoms of severe diaper rash include red, inflamed skin, blisters, and pain. In some cases, the rash can become infected, leading to more severe symptoms such as fever and pus.

The most common cause of severe diaper rash is irritation from urine and feces. When urine and feces come into contact with the skin, they can break down the skin’s natural barrier, leading to irritation and inflammation. This can be exacerbated by factors such as infrequent diaper changes, tight diapers, and the use of harsh wipes or soaps. Allergic reactions to diaper materials or wipes can also cause severe diaper rash. Some babies may be allergic to the dyes, fragrances, or other chemicals used in diapers or wipes, leading to an allergic reaction.

In addition to these causes, other factors can contribute to the development of severe diaper rash. For example, antibiotics can disrupt the balance of bacteria in the gut, leading to an overgrowth of yeast and bacteria that can cause diaper rash. Similarly, babies who are taking antibiotics or have a weakened immune system may be more susceptible to severe diaper rash. What causes severe diaper rash in babies?

Severe diaper rash in babies can be caused by a combination of factors, including prolonged exposure to urine and feces, friction from tight diapers, and allergic reactions to certain diaper materials or laundry detergents. When urine and feces come into contact with the skin, they can break down the skin’s natural barrier and cause irritation. Additionally, bacteria and fungi can thrive in the warm, moist environment of a diaper, leading to infection and further irritation.

To prevent severe diaper rash, it’s essential to keep the diaper area clean and dry, change diapers frequently, and use a diaper cream or ointment to protect the skin. Parents can also take steps to reduce the risk of diaper rash, such as using breathable diapers, avoiding tight clothing, and washing cloth diapers in mild detergent. By taking these precautions, parents can help reduce the risk of severe diaper rash and keep their baby’s skin healthy and comfortable.

When should I seek medical attention for a severe diaper rash?

If your baby’s severe diaper rash is accompanied by a fever, discharge, or foul odor, it’s essential to seek medical attention right away. These symptoms can indicate a bacterial or fungal infection, which requires prompt treatment to prevent complications. Additionally, if the rash is not improving with treatment, or if it’s spreading to other areas of the body, you should consult with a pediatrician for further guidance.

The pediatrician can examine the rash, take a medical history, and provide a proper diagnosis and treatment plan. In some cases, the pediatrician may prescribe antibiotics or antifungal medications to clear up the infection. They may also provide guidance on how to manage the rash, reduce discomfort, and promote healing.
